John:2:12-25




nkjv@John:2:12 @ After this He went down to Capernaum, He, His mother, His brothers, and His disciples; and they did not stay there many days.

nkjv@John:2:13 @ Now the Passover of the Jews was at hand, and Jesus went up to Jerusalem.

nkjv@John:2:14 @ And He found in the temple those who sold oxen and sheep and doves, and the money changers doing business.

nkjv@John:2:15 @ When He had made a whip of cords, He drove them all out of the temple, with the sheep and the oxen, and poured out the changers' money and overturned the tables.

nkjv@John:2:16 @ And He said to those who sold doves, "Take these things away! Do not make My Father's house a house of merchandise!"

nkjv@John:2:17 @ Then His disciples remembered that it was written, "Zeal for Your house has eaten Me up."

nkjv@John:2:18 @ So the Jews answered and said to Him, "What sign do You show to us, since You do these things?"

nkjv@John:2:19 @ Jesus answered and said to them, "Destroy this temple, and in three days I will raise it up."

nkjv@John:2:20 @ Then the Jews said, "It has taken forty-six years to build this temple, and will You raise it up in three days?"

nkjv@John:2:21 @ But He was speaking of the temple of His body.

nkjv@John:2:22 @ Therefore, when He had risen from the dead, His disciples remembered that He had said this to them; and they believed the Scripture and the word which Jesus had said.

nkjv@John:2:23 @ Now when He was in Jerusalem at the Passover, during the feast, many believed in His name when they saw the signs which He did.

nkjv@John:2:24 @ But Jesus did not commit Himself to them, because He knew all men,

nkjv@John:2:25 @ and had no need that anyone should testify of man, for He knew what was in man.
